The postcode PO40 9PU is located in Isle of Wight It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PO40 9PU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

PO40 9PU is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PO40 9PU as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Detached rural retirement.

The closest road name to PO40 9PU is Everard Close which is centered 70 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Guyers Road and is 112 m away.

The closest primary school to PO40 9PU (for ages 11 and under) is St Saviour's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on January 22, 2019.

The local pub for residents of PO40 9PU is Freshwater Conservative Club and is 784 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Exempt on September 7, 2016.

Residents reported an average download speed of 28.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 6.1 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 96.3%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 3.7%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.2 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for PO40 9PU is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Isle of Wight National Health Service is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
